Abstract

Un sistema y aparato que reduce la fricción de los neumáticos en un camión y/o remolque durante los giros. El sistema minimiza la redistribución de la carga entre los neumáticos, lo que reparte la carga del remolque o camión entre los neumáticos evitando sobrecargas innecesarias. El sistema funciona sin la intervención del operario y puede funcionar automáticamente en remolques sin señales de control provenientes del camión.
